    riddle is solved.

    For those who like it...
    I'm dissapointed, Sea battles over all...

    Muskets and cannons, where are my beloved swords and spears?

    a few things from the german article
    -game takes place during the 18th century.
    -featuring america's way into independence an the race to the eastern trade routes.
    -gunpowder is important, so tactical changes should be made during battles.
    -board enemy ships and battle to victory through melee.
    -improved diplomacy, trade and espionage on campaign map.
    -you can control single ships or navies.(sounds a little bit arcade for my taste)
